-
Type:
Bug
-
Status: Closed
-
Resolution: Won't Fix
-
Affects Version/s: 6.0.6 GA
-
Fix Version/s: --Sprint 12/11, 6.1.0 CE RC1
-
Component/s: ~[Archived] WCM
I have Richfaces4 based Lifray Portal deployed on Tomcat 6. I have problem in viewing the skin. I am using JSF2, Facelets, Richfaces4, portletfaces-bridge-2.0.0. Initially i was getting url as /test/rfRes/skinning.ecss?db=eAHzX7%21yOgAFdgJ%
After i made below chnage in org.portletfaces.bridge.application.ResourceHandlerImpl.java
public static boolean isFacesResourceURL(String url) {
if ((url != null) && (url.indexOf(JAVAX_FACES_RESOURCE) >= 0 || url.indexOf(RICH_FACES_RESOURCE) >= 0))
{ return true; }else
{ return false; }}
I am getting URL as
Still i don't see the css loaded properly. I am not sure what i am missing.
Web.xml
<context-param>
<param-name>org.richfaces.skin</param-name>
<param-value>classic</param-value>
</context-param>
<!-- wine, ruby, blueSky, classic,deepMarine, DEFAULT, emeraldTown, japanCherry,
plain -->
<context-param>
<param-name>org.richfaces.fileUpload.maxRequestSize</param-name>
<param-value>100000</param-value>
</context-param>
<context-param>
<param-name>org.richfaces.fileUpload.createTempFiles</param-name>
<param-value>false</param-value>
</context-param>
<context-param>
<param-name>org.richfaces.enableControlSkinning</param-name>
<param-value>true</param-value>
</context-param>
<context-param>
<param-name>org.richfaces.enableControlSkinningClasses</param-name>
<param-value>false</param-value>
</context-param>
<context-param>
<param-name>javax.faces.PROJECT_STAGE</param-name>
<param-value>Development</param-value>
</context-param>
<context-param>
<param-name>javax.faces.STATE_SAVING_METHOD</param-name>
<param-value>server</param-value>
</context-param>